+        /* AES encryption is required for Level 4:
+         *
+         * BLUETOOTH CORE SPECIFICATION Version 5.2 | Vol 3, Part C
+         * page 1319:
+         *
+         * 128-bit equivalent strength for link and encryption keys
+         * required using FIPS approved algorithms (E0 not allowed,
+         * SAFER+ not allowed, and P-192 not allowed; encryption key
+         * not shortened)
+         */
+       if (conn->sec_level == BT_SECURITY_FIPS &&
+           !test_bit(HCI_CONN_AES_CCM, &conn->flags)) {
+               bt_dev_err(conn->hdev,
+                          "Invalid security: Missing AES-CCM usage");
+               return 0;
+       }
